About Sushi Village

Sushi Village, located at 8 Raymond Ave, Poughkeepsie, NY, provides a Japanese dining experience. While categorized as a Chinese restaurant, it specializes in sushi and other Japanese dishes.

Customer reviews highlight the restaurant's diverse menu and quality ingredients. The Godzilla Roll is a popular item, described as having a hearty warm flavor and deep-fried texture. Customers appreciate its fusion cuisine style.

Sushi Village also offers an "all you can eat" Japanese food special, which has been positively reviewed. The lunch buffet and sashimi have also received favorable comments, with sashimi described as "perfect."

The restaurant provides both individual dishes and buffet options, catering to different dining preferences. The atmosphere is suitable for casual dining, including lunches with coworkers.
